Temperate forests are those found in the direct atmospheres between the tropics and boreal areas in both the Northern and Southern Hemisphere. They may likewise be designated "four-season forests" in light of the fact that the midlatitude atmospheres harboring them tend to encounter four unmistakable seasons. Weaving greatly improved under the Han, especially of silk which, using new foot-powered looms, could have as many as 220 warp threads per centimetre of cloth. Innovations were also made in science such as the use of sundials and primitive seismographs. In medicine, one popular development was the use of acupuncture
